How Our Water Damage Restoration Service Works
Our water damage restoration service is a meticulous process that needs attention to detail and a deep understanding of the underlying science. We start by assessing the extent of the damage, using specialized equipment to identify areas of moisture and potential hazards. From there, we use drying protocols and containment procedures to prevent further damage and ensure that the affected area is safe for your family.
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Our team will arrive at your home and assess the extent of the damage, identifying areas of moisture and potential hazards. We’ll then contain the affected area to prevent further damage and ensure that the space is safe for your family.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to measure moisture levels and identify potential hazards.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
Once the affected area has been contained, our team will use specialized equipment to extract any standing water and begin the drying process. We’ll use powerful fans and d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ture and speed up the drying process. This process can take anywhere from 24-48 hours, dep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ing
With the affected area dry and safe, our team will begin the process of cleaning and sanitizing the space. This includes removing any damaged materials, cleaning and disinfecting surfaces, and restoring your home to its former condition. Our team takes pride in leaving your home looking like new.
Step 4: Final Inspections and Touch-ups
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the affected area is safe and secure. We’ll make any necessary touch-ups and provide you with a thorough report on the work we’ve done. Our goal is to leave your home looking and feeling like new.

Water Damage Restoration Cost in Dedham, MA
The cost of water damage restoration can vary widely, dep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Typically, you can expect to pay anywhere from $500 to $2,500 or more for water damage restoration in Dedham, MA. The cost will depend on the extent of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500-$2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200-$1,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ning required |
| Final Inspections and Touch-ups | $100-$500 | Size of affected area, type of repairs required |
